Meteorological and climatological aspects of Otto Nordenskjöld's Antarctic expedition / Deliang Chen, Klaus Wyser.

Title: Meteorological and climatological aspects of Otto Nordenskjöld's Antarctic expedition / Deliang Chen, Klaus Wyser.
Author(s): Chen, Deliang.
Wyser, Klaus.
Date: 2004.
Publisher: Göteborg, Sweden: Royal Society of Arts and Sciences
In: Antarctic challenges. Historical and current perspectives on Otto Nordenskjöld's Antarctic expedition, 1901-1903. (2004.),
Abstract: Summarises meteorological and climatological activities of Nordenskjöld's 1901-04 Antarctic expedition, and puts them into context of historical development of Antarctic meteorology.
